HashMap存储结构浅析 1.hashmap是按照存储结构来讲是数组(散列桶)与链表的组合体.2. 如何计算hashmap中的散列桶的位...
HashMap的数据结构为:数组+(链表或红黑树)hashmap的数据结构 为什么采用这种结构来存储元素呢?数组的特点:查询效...
HashMap,中文名哈希映射,HashMap是一个用于存储Key-Value键值对的集合,每一个键值对也叫做Entry。这些个键值对(...
在java编程语言中,最基本的结构就是两种,一个是数组,另外一个是模拟指针(引用),所有的数据结构都可以用这两个基本结构来构造的,HashMap也不例外。HashMap实...
(1)HashMap底层实现数据结构为数组+链表的形式,JDK8及其以后的版本中使用了数组+链表+红黑树实现,解决了链表太长导致的查询速度变慢的问题。 (2...
java中HashMap类是用来存储具有键值对特征的数据。例如现在需要按照员工号来存储大量的员工信息,那么就可以使用HashMap,将员工号作为键,员工对象作为值来存储到...
Map:
hashmap低层是有一个数组类型是Entry和链表(Entry这个类有创建了一个链表)的结构构成的,你说的NULL为空是,是不是k值为空,低层会跟K为空的Entry table [0]下的...
Map:
HashMap中的红黑树节点 采用的是TreeNode 类 TreeNode和Entry都是Node的子类,也就说Node可能是链表结构,也可能是红黑树结构。如果插入的key的hashcode相同,那么...
其他小伙伴的相似问题3 | ||
---|---|---|
HashMap是干嘛的 | HashMap和Hashtable的区别 | 数据结构有四种结构分别是 |
层次模型的数据结构是什么结构 | hash表的数据结构 | javahashmap原理 |
hashtable底层数据结构 | 哈希表属于逻辑结构 | hashmap的时间复杂度是多少 |
什么是哈希冲突 | 返回首页 |
返回顶部 |